コーディングのガイドライン coding-guidelines
ガイドライン、ヒントとテクニック guidelines-tips-and-tricks
AEM Communitiesの使用は、Java Server Pages に大きく依存することから、ビジネスロジック、スタイル、ページコンテンツが互いに異なるテンプレートスクリプティング言語を柔軟に選択できるように進化しました。
ユーザー生成コンテンツ (UGC) を柔軟に操作できるのは、SocialResourceProvider API を使用することです。UGC では、どのコンテンツを認識する必要がなくなります SRP オプションがデプロイメント用に選択されました。
AEM Communities開発者向けの様々なコーディングガイドラインおよびベストプラクティスを次に示します。
コード code
- SRP を使用した UGC へのアクセス - UGC が JCR(JSRP) に格納されている場合にのみ機能するアプリケーションを記述しないようにする方法
- SocialUtils リファクタリング - SocialUtils に代わる SRP のユーティリティメソッド。
- 命名規則 — カスタム Java クラスの命名規則。
スクリプト scripts
- コミュニティコンポーネントのサイドロード — ページの読み込み後に、コンポーネントを動的に追加する方法。
- リッチテキストエディターの基本事項 — メンバーがコンテンツを投稿するために提供するリッチテキスト UI をカスタマイズする方法。
IDE ide
- コミュニティでの Maven の使用 — コミュニティ API jar を含める方法。
- SocialUtils リファクタリング - SocialUtils に代わる SRP のユーティリティメソッド。
recommendation-more-help
5d37d7b0-a330-461b-814d-068612705ff6